What is Bonded glass?

Bonded glass is a way to seal materials with an intermediate glass layer. It is used for micro machined structures and uses low melting glass.

What are the glass structures called that are used to mount specimens?

The glass structures used to mount specimens are called glass slides. They provide a flat surface for placing specimens for examination under a microscope or for other imaging purposes. Glass slides are commonly used in laboratory settings for various scientific and medical applications.

When is tempered glass required for construction projects?

Tempered glass is required for construction projects when the glass is located in areas where there is a higher risk of breakage or where safety is a concern, such as in doors, windows, and shower enclosures.
